Business process modelling - PowerPoint PPT Presentation

1 / 25
About This Presentation
Title:

Business process modelling

Description:

... processes to maintain state data and process history based on messages exchanged. ... This information identifies the functionality that must be provided by the ... – PowerPoint PPT presentation

Number of Views:92
Avg rating:3.0/5.0
Slides: 26
Provided by: joona2
Category:

less

Transcript and Presenter's Notes

Title: Business process modelling


1
Business process modelling
  • Enn Õunapuu
  • Tallinna Tehnikaülikool
  • enn_at_cc.ttu.ee
  • 372 050 97720

2
Business process definition
  • A process is a specific ordering of work
    activities across time and place, with a
    beginning, an end, and clearly defined inputs and
    outputs a structure for action1. Business
    processes are both internal and external to
    autonomous business entities, and drive their
    collaboration to achieve shared business goals by
    enabling highly fluid process networks. Such
    business goals include end-to-end efficiency,
    transformation empowerment, and value management.

3
Business process
  • Business processes are adaptive structures for
    action through which many participantsIT
    systems, applications, users, partners, and other
    processesplay a variety of roles. Business
    Process Management enables the collaboration of
    such participants in a reliable, scalable, and
    secure manner, by supporting dynamic process
    topologies that allow the boundary between
    processes and participants to be determined
    on-the-fly by long-term and real-time business
    goals, while retaining synchronized public
    interfaces associated with trading partner
    agreements.

4
(No Transcript)
5
(No Transcript)
6
(No Transcript)
7
(No Transcript)
8
(No Transcript)
9
(No Transcript)
10
(No Transcript)
11
(No Transcript)
12
(No Transcript)
13
(No Transcript)
14
Synchronizing parallel activities
15
Business process executable language
16
BPEL
  • l The ltcontainersgt section defines the data
    containers used by the process, providing their
    definitions in terms of WSDL message types.
    Containers allow processes to maintain state data
    and process history based on messages exchanged.
  • l The ltpartnersgt section defines the different
    parties that interact with the business process
    in the course of processing the order. The four
    partners shown here correspond to the sender of
    the order (customer), as well as the providers of
    price (invoiceProvider), shipment
    (shippingProvider), and manufacturing scheduling
    services (schedulingProvider). Each partner is
    characterized by a service link type and a role
    name. This information identifies the
    functionality that must be provided by the
    business process and by the partner for the
    relationship to succeed, that is, the portTypes
    that the purchase order process and the partner
    need to implement.

17
(No Transcript)
18
(No Transcript)
19
(No Transcript)
20
(No Transcript)
21
(No Transcript)
22
(No Transcript)
23
(No Transcript)
24
(No Transcript)
25
Thank You
Write a Comment
User Comments (0)
About PowerShow.com